Modular industrial plant design company JordProxa, headquartered in Australia, and lithium brinefield technology provider Zelandez, based in Argentina, have signed a partnership to rapidly increase the supply of lithium from North and South American lithium brine mining companies.

The partnership’s main focus will be deployment of Zelandez’s Early Lithium Carbonation Facility (ErLi), a prefabricated unit for production of lithium carbonate leased from Zelandez and designed for early extraction of high-quality lithium reserves before permanent facilities are built. JordProxa will provide engineering, fabrication and ongoing technical support for the ErLi modules.

“If we want to increase the supply of lithium into the US, the key is to build prefabricated lithium plants—and a lot of them,” said Zelandez co-founder and Director Clint Van Marrewijk.

Elie Sakhat, Director of JordProxa, commented, “The ErLi concept from Zelandez improves the integration of the lithium production process and will unlock more high-quality lithium assets.”
